<acronym dir="gmuzki"></acronym><bdo date-time="jp4ojy"></bdo><legend lang="4hnrzk"></legend><time lang="jvgr76"></time><ins date-time="xt5j7o"></ins><code id="h50m8k"></code><strong draggable="1h_gh6"></strong><em dropzone="g9l9gb"></em>

从 TP 到 Tomo:安卓端创建、优化与运维 TomoChain 的完整策略

本文面向希望在 TP(TokenPocket)安卓最新版中添加并使用 TomoChain 的开发者与运维人员,提供从下载、网络配置到高可用部署、DApp 选择、手续费优化、实时监控与智能合约安全的系统化流程。文中引用 TomoChain 官方文档、TokenPocket 官方说明、以太坊黄皮书与 pBFT 等权威资料进行推理与验证,确保准确可靠(参考文献列于文末)。

一、在 TP(Android) 中创建 TomoChain(主网)

步骤要点(主网参数,2025 年一般通用):

- 网络名称:TomoChain Mainnet

- RPC URL:https://rpc.tomochain.com

- Chain ID:88

- 代币符号:TOMO

- 区块浏览器:https://scan.tomochain.com

操作流程:

1) 从 TokenPocket 官方站或可信应用市场下载并安装 TP 安卓最新版,避免第三方 APK。2) 打开 TP,进入 钱包/管理 或设置 -> 链管理(不同版本 UI 可能略有差异)。3) 选择 添加网络 或 添加自定义网络,按上文参数填写并保存。4) 切换到 TomoChain 网络,先用小额转账做连通性与手续费测试。5) 如遇 RPC 连接失败,尝试更换为官方备用节点或使用自建 RPC(见高可用部分)。此处的步骤依据 TokenPocket 官方说明与 TomoChain 文档进行组织以保证兼容性[1][2]。

二、高可用性(HA)设计要点

推理与建议:移动钱包面临的不稳定主要来自 RPC 不可用与网络延迟。基于此,推荐多层保障:

- 部署多个 RPC 节点(自建或托管),放置于不同云区域并配置负载均衡与健康检查;

- 在钱包或 DApp 后端保留多个 RPC 地址作为备用,并实现自动切换策略;

- 使用 Prometheus + Grafana 做节点与服务监控,关键指标包括区块高度滞后、RPC 延迟、txpool 长度与错误率;

- 对高价值账户采用多签与冷签名策略,降低单点私钥风险。上述架构兼顾可用性与安全性,同时须评估 PoSV 共识下节点集中化的治理风险[1][5]。

三、DApp 推荐(按类别与评估原则)

建议优先体验与集成类型:去中心化交易所(DEX,如 TomoX 等)、跨链桥、NFT 市场、借贷协议、链上治理工具。选择时应以开源、审计记录、TVL(锁仓量)与交易活跃度为主要评价指标,可以通过 TomoScan、DappRadar 等第三方平台验证项目热度与安全性。

四、专家剖析(权衡与推理)

基于 TomoChain 的 PoSV(Proof-of-Stake Voting)与 EVM 兼容性,可推理出其优势为低手续费、较快确认与良好的以太坊兼容迁移路径;但节点投票机制可能造成一定的中心化倾向,需要在网络安全、去中心化与性能之间做平衡。参考以太坊黄皮书与 pBFT 研究,可用理论支持对最终性与容错性的评估[4][5]。

五、手续费设置与优化

手续费由 gas price 与 gas limit 决定,单位以 TOMO 支付。一般代币转账的 gas 消耗级别可参考 EVM 标准(例如约 21000 gas 起步),复杂合约调用显著更高。实务建议:

- 在 TP 发起交易时使用钱包的建议费率或查询 TomoScan 的实时推荐值;

- 对时间敏感交易适当乘以 1.1–2 的加价系数以提高上链概率;

- 在合约开发阶段通过本地模拟与测试网预估 gas 消耗,避免上线后高额失败成本。

六、实时数据分析与监控实践

链上数据:使用 TomoScan 与 The Graph 做索引与快速查询;链下监控:Prometheus 抓取 RPC/节点暴露的指标,Grafana 做可视化,结合 Alertmanager 进行告警。关键分析流程包括采集(RPC 调用、节点指标)、清洗(聚合 tx/区块/延迟)、建模(TPS、确认时间分布)与告警阈值设定。

七、先进智能合约开发与安全

开发建议:采用 Solidity >=0.8.x、重用 OpenZeppelin 标准库、使用 Hardhat/Truffle 做自动化测试。安全层面需做静态分析(Slither)、模糊测试与第三方审计(MythX/CertiK 等)。若采用可升级模式,配合时间锁与多签治理以降低升级风险。

八、详细分析流程(可复制工作流)

1) 定义目标与风险;2) 在测试网完成功能与压力测试;3) 建立 CI/CD 与自动化测试;4) 预部署 Canary release;5) 主网部署并开启监控;6) 定期审计与社区反馈循环。常用监测 API 包括 eth_blockNumber、eth_getTransactionByHash、net_peerCount 等,可用于自动化健康检查。

结论:通过在 TP 安卓端正确添加 TomoChain 网络并结合自建或托管的高可用 RPC、严谨的合约开发与完善的监控体系,可以在保证用户体验的同时最大化安全与可用性。本指南基于权威文档与共识研究进行推理与实务建议,适用于个人开发者与企业级部署。

互动投票(请选择一个选项并投票):

1) 你准备在 TP(Android) 上添加 TomoChain 吗?A:已添加 B:准备添加 C:先测试网 D:不考虑

2) 在接入 TomoChain 时你最关心哪个方面?A:高可用性 B:手续费 C:智能合约安全 D:DApp 生态

3) 对于是否自建 RPC 节点你更倾向于?A:自建 B:云托管 C:混合 D:不确定

参考文献:

[1] TomoChain 官方文档,https://docs.tomochain.com/

[2] TokenPocket 官方网站与帮助中心,https://www.tokenpocket.pro/

[3] G. Wood, Ethereum Yellow Paper, 2014, https://ethereum.github.io/yellowpaper/paper.pdf

[4] M. Castro, B. Liskov, Practical Byzantine Fault Tolerance, OSDI 1999, https://pmg.csail.mit.edu/papers/osdi99.pdf

[5] Solidity 官方文档,https://docs.soliditylang.org/

作者:李文博发布时间:2025-08-14 20:15:57

评论

Alex8

按照步骤配置成功了,多谢详尽说明!很受用。

小雨

请问添加自定义 RPC 时 TP 出现超时,我是先用备用节点还是直接搭自建节点?

CryptoFan

专家剖析部分写得很到位,关于 PoSV 的中心化风险值得社区持续关注。

陈博士

能否补充一份快速搭建 TomoChain 全节点的脚本示例,方便企业级部署?

Sakura

合约安全那段很实用,想知道如何选择合适的审计机构和预算范围。

相关阅读